So, Friendo here (i.e., Sierra, my 24lb human daughter), recently discovered the doggy door. For a while she has known about the doggy door and has been throwing her toys out the plastic flap only to land outside - out of reach and in Bobo's (our 8lb dog's) way of getting back into the house.
We were sitting in the living room the other night when she discovered that not only do her toys fit though the door, but she herself could probably fit too! It was quite funny. She didn't actually get her whole body through the door, but she got enough of herself that she could reach her toys.
I realized later that this is sort of what we do with God. There is a verse in the Bible that says, "God will shut doors that no man can open and will open doors that no man can shut." If she was a little smarter and wiser, she would realize that about 3 inches away from the doggy door is a "real", human door! It only takes someone with the ability and authority to open it for her. Once opened, she could easily make her way outside to her valued toys and even more open space.
That's what we do with God. Instead of being patient and waiting for God to open the door, we try to fit our lives through a small area that God never intended. Life doesn't have to be this difficult. If we would just wait for God, the one with authority and ability, to open the door then life would be SO MUCH EASIER!
So, whatever you are waiting on, whatever you are hoping for, whatever you desire - wait for it. Let God open the door that no man can shut and shut the door that no man can open. It will make life that much easier!
